Output 68868725a39ee42fae4fb1cc3da620ce33641a32a3d15ecd31d6a275aa04c5f1:0

value
129004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d146f980fd899c00d7d78022d52137239b62771a OP_EQUAL
address
3LmaB3FiZnZLtjYLoQeh5FCjPGjWdjRfzZ
transaction
68868725a39ee42fae4fb1cc3da620ce33641a32a3d15ecd31d6a275aa04c5f1
spent
true